Episode 44: düber
Manage episode 174388518 series 1402155
Drew and James open the show with a quick chat about community as well as the results of the Vancouver Programming Survey. The guest this week is an anonymous guest from düber!
düber is a system for marijuana vendors to track and maintain their inventory as well as make sure they are staying within the regulations for the substance. If you are wondering why his name is not here, then you should listen to this episode! We talk about what düber is, how new industries affect technology, and the current legality, and future legality, of marijuana.
